  • What advice would you give a customer looking to hire a provider in your area of work?

    If you have water entering your home then it would be best to call a waterproofer versus a general contractor or roofer. Most of the times a good waterproofer can find your leaks immediately and offer much less expensive solutions when compared to a regular contractor who will often want to charge you a lot of money to take everything apart and start all over again.
